Output 72905159830fba993cbc184c945cbe597433486607c9292af3ae91e5edbb5a70:1

value
2631597
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f21e23b3dabf57abc7574f7b9eb9b34b28848ff6 OP_EQUALVERIFY OP_CHECKSIG
address
1P5CdYskucKJiUkAg8QXiSupauuM3F3jck
transaction
72905159830fba993cbc184c945cbe597433486607c9292af3ae91e5edbb5a70
spent
true